Excerpt from Christian Socialism Socialism, after a season of comparative quiescence, has of late once more assumed a threatening attitude. It is at this moment producing considerable agitation in several European countries, and has been the subject of diplomatic activity among their governments. Now, every movement which is strong enough to engage public attention will appear in a different light to different individuals and bodies of men according to their per sonal standpoint or corporate position. This applies more especially to movements affecting the well - being of society, as a whole, inasmuch as they aim at changes in the existing order vitally affecting large classes of men. The Church and the religious world, therefore, may justly regard the socialistic movement of the day from their own standpoint without incurring, or at least without meriting, the charge of religious bias. Excerpt from Christian Socialism and Its Opponents And I trust that those of us who have entered upon this undertaking, have done so, not although, but be cause they were lawyers. It may be that the practice of litigation has led them to long for some more har monious resolution of social difficulties; it may be that the study of technicalities made them seek after some application of a more simple, and, as it were, living law; or, again, that the penning of verbose Acts of Parliament, destined to remain a dead letter to the masses, made them feel the gulf that separates the statute-book from the nation that it nominally rules; or that a familiarity with the construction of commer cial partnerships and companies made them more and more aware of the total absence of legal facilities for the association of Labour. They found thus, in this movement, 0 work ready to their hand, for portions at least of which all previous experience seemed to have specially fitted them; and whatever may or may not be the ill-results, upon their present or future earnings, of the step they have taken, I believe they have no reason to repent of it. They are still labouring in their vocation, fulfilling their appointed duties, learning to frame, learning to apply, a most real and practical law.
